Abstract

The utility model discloses a yarn cluster conveyer belt which is characterized by comprising a first rail, a second rail, a connecting base, a fixed disc, a rotating disc, a rotation shaft and a yarn cluster support. The first rail is parallel to the second rail, the connecting base is arranged on the first rail and the second rail in a sliding mode, the fixed disc is fixed on the connecting base, the rotating disc is fixed at one end of the rotation shaft, the rotation shaft is installed on the fixed disc in a rotary mode, a driven gear is fixed on the rotation shaft, a rotation motor is fixed on the fixed disc, a driving gear is fixed on an output shaft of the rotation motor, the driving gear is meshed with the driven gear, and the yarn cluster support is fixed on the rotating disc. Compared with the prior art, the yarn cluster conveyer belt has the advantages of being practical and simple in structure, capable of automatically conveying yarn clusters, and small in passing area.

Background technology
In the factory of weaving gauze, the gauze of having weaved adopts the winding-structure of long cylinder conventionally, and existing gauze adopts a dead lift conventionally, not only waste time and energy, and in workshop some narrow space by time, also easily touch dirty cloth, break equipment, cause certain economic loss.

The specific embodiment
Below in conjunction with accompanying drawing and by embodiment, the utility model is described in further detail, and following examples are to explanation of the present utility model and the utility model is not limited to following examples.
Referring to Fig. 1-Fig. 2, the present embodiment yarn group load-transfer device, comprise the first track 1, the second track 2, Connection Block 3, reaction plate 4, rolling disc 5, rotating shaft 6 and yarn group support 7, the first track 1 is parallel with the second track 2, Connection Block 3 is slidably arranged on the first track 1 and the second track 2, reaction plate 4 is fixed on Connection Block 3, rolling disc 5 is fixed on one end of rotating shaft 6, rotating shaft 6 is rotatably installed on reaction plate 4, in rotating shaft 6, be fixed with driven gear 8, on reaction plate 4, be fixed with rotation motor, on the output shaft of rotation motor, be fixed with driving gear 9, driving gear 9 and driven gear 8 engagements.Yarn group's support 7 is fixed on rolling disc 5, adopts this structure, and yarn group is placed on yarn group support 7, Connection Block 3 can move around on the first track 1, the second track 2, realize automatic transporting, due to yarn, group laterally places more for convenience, when therefore placing, yarn group is horizontal, but because yarn group horizontally set is larger by area, be not suitable for by the narrow and small occasion of area, by rotating rolling disc 5, it is axially consistent with throughput direction that yarn is rolled into a ball, and reduced and passed through area.
On the present embodiment the first track 1, be fixed with driving rack, on Connection Block 3, be rotatablely equipped with transmission gear, transmission gear and driving rack engagement, transmission gear is driven by a drive motor.Yarn group's support 7 comprises the first support and the second support, adopts this structure, not only simple in structure, and the manoevreability of transmission is good.
